Webster's 1828 Dictionary

ANACARDIUM

n.The cashew-nut, or marking nut, which produces a thickish, red, caustic, inflammable liquor, which, when used in marking, turns black, and is very durable.

 

Webster's 1913 Dictionary

ANACARDIUM

An `a *car "di *um, n. Etym: [NL. , fr. Gr. (Bot. )

 

Defn: A genus of plants including the cashew tree. See Cashew.
